I am not sure the Simpsons, nor the ¡Three Amigos! examples fit, as neither are over the shoulder, nor in a blind-spot. They do both qualify as Littering Is No Big Deal, though.

Two missing examples:

In the Pixar movie Monsters Inc. when Sully is holding a garbage cube that he mistakenly thinks Boo was crushed in. Then he and Mike realize that Boo is fine and Sully tosses it over his shoulder in immediate dismissal in order to run to Boo. The cube lands on Mike.

In the Disney movie Cool Runnings: Sanka has just revealed the hot-water bottle hidden in his coat when coach Irv walks up. Irv takes away the water-bladder and tosses it over his shoulder despite there being many people around them it could have hit. Also counts as Littering Is No Big Deal.

Fogg in Around The World In Eighty Days 2004, after stating that rules are made to be broken, or, uh, stabbed by a spiky shoe, promptly tosses said shoe over his shoulder after liberating his rule-book off the hidden knife. This being a comedy, it is somewhat surprising that it doesn't hit anything.
